Output 86b87a8d25536cf6c3f6d2c6071273875bcb6f99ea426dc49ced7c8866b525f7:11

value
1850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ce6e0e142dfd0edf8bde49f90b399a3edcc450a OP_EQUAL
address
3FzdvBePyUxpKvYkgueX4exA6QweEWKtis
transaction
86b87a8d25536cf6c3f6d2c6071273875bcb6f99ea426dc49ced7c8866b525f7
confirmations
403600
spent
true